Man arrested in fatal stabbing of ex-girlfriend in front of her mom

A man accused of fatally stabbing his ex-girlfriend whom he met Friday night at a convenience store to return some property was taken into custody on Monday. 

Mark Wayne Meade, 40, was being held without bail at the Clark County Detention Center on one count of murder. He didn’t make his initial court hearing Tuesday morning for a “medical” reason, Las Vegas Justice Court logs show.

Metro Police were called out about 8:30 p.m. to a convenience store near Buffalo and Westcliff drives where they found a woman fatally wounded.

Reports identified the victim as Kathy Blanco, 30. Her mother witnessed her slaying, Lt. Ray Spencer said.

The couple had just broken up and moved out of an apartment but had agreed to meet at a public place to exchange some belongings, Spencer said.

Blanco did everything right by meeting him in public and bringing her mother along, Spencer said. 

Meade took off running after the stabbing but was arrested in a neighborhood located about a quarter-mile from the crime scene by a task force that comprises the FBI and local police, Metro said. 

A copy of Meade’s arrest report wasn’t immediately available Tuesday afternoon.
